Technical Specifications and Product Variants
Understanding the technical specifications of articulating paper is the first step in defining procurement requirements. The market offers a diverse array of models, each designed for specific clinical applications. Observed product attributes indicate that these instruments are primarily categorized by their physical shape and thickness. The "Straight" and "Horse Shoe" types represent the two dominant physical forms, catering to different mouth geometries and access requirements within the dental department.
Thickness is a critical specification that directly influences the sensitivity of the occlusal marking. Data indicates that available standards include thicknesses of 30, 100, and 200 micrometers (μm). Some suppliers offer a "Think or Thin" specification, alongside specific color codes such as red, blue, and green. The color selection is not merely aesthetic; it often serves to differentiate between upper and lower arch markings or to indicate varying levels of abrasiveness. For instance, red and blue are frequently cited as standard options, while some listings mention green as an additional variant.
The physical construction of the paper also varies. While some products are described as having a "PVC" material composition, others are defined by their paper-based nature. The packaging formats are equally diverse, ranging from small boxes containing 12 books to larger cartons holding 50 or 100 boxes. A common configuration observed is 10 books per box with 20 sheets per book, packed into cartons of 50 boxes. Another variation involves 12 pieces per box. Typical Applications and Departmental Usage
The versatility of articulating paper is evident in its broad range of applications. The primary usage is within the Dental Department, where it is essential for checking occlusion after the placement of crowns, bridges, and fillings. The "Fuction" is explicitly listed as "Dental Purpose," confirming its specialized role. Beyond general dentistry, the product is also applicable to the Orthodontic Department, where it is used to adjust braces and aligners.
The "Usage" attribute reveals an extensive list of potential applications, including die making, model making, denture processing, and bonding material application. This suggests that articulating paper is not limited to clinical chairside use but also plays a role in the laboratory setting. For instance, it is used in "Model Making" and "Die Making," which are critical steps in fabricating prosthetics. The product also serves as a "Dental Preventive Health Care Material," indicating its role in routine check-ups and preventive care strategies.

Quality Control and Long-Term Procurement Considerations
Quality control is essential for maintaining the integrity of dental procedures. The "Standard" of 30/100/200μm provides a benchmark for thickness consistency. Buyers should verify that the supplier maintains strict tolerances within these ranges to ensure accurate occlusal marking. Inconsistent thickness can lead to false occlusal contacts, resulting in patient discomfort and the need for rework. The "Color" consistency is also vital; variations in red or blue shades can confuse clinical staff and compromise the accuracy of the procedure.
